Jordan Romano left The bases loaded in the ninth inning, only for a tiebreaking single by Vladimir Guerrero Jr. to give the Toronto Blue Jays a 2-1 victory over the New York Yankees on Wednesday.

Romano is the leader of the Major Leagues with 12 saves in 13 opportunities. Toronto avoided the sweep in the series of three duels.

New York’s 11-game winning streak was the franchise’s longest since it strung together. 13 between August 14 and 27, 2021.

Yankees manager Aaron Boone was ejected by home plate umpire Marty Foster after discussing balls and strikes during an at-bat Aaron Judge in the eighth inning. Foster testified struck out Judge on a pitch that seemed low in the sixth inning.
